Zagreb hosts 'happy English visitors'

England fans have enjoyed a night to remember in Zagreb, following the country's World Cup qualifying clash with Croatia in the Maksimir Stadium, it has been revealed.

The BBC reports the travelling supporters were "exhilarated" after the game, which ended 4-1 to the visitors.

Before the game most Croatian fans were optimistic, while their English counterparts were anything but.

Tom Baigoli's remarks to the news provider summed up the feelings of those who had made their way to the Balkan country to take in the match.

He said: "Unbelievable. Insane. Absolutely phenomenal. We never saw it coming. It's the best game I've ever been to."

Croatian head coach Slaven Bilic was gracious in defeat and even went as far as to claim England may be the best team in Europe after watching his compatriots lose their first home match in ten years.

He reserved particular praise for England's hat-trick hero, Theo Walcott, describing the Arsenal players as "so exceptionally dangerous".
